Despite the probable illegality of the decision to CLOSE the Bloedel Conservatory, the Vancouver Park Board has moved ahead with their decision to accept Expressions of Interest (EOIs) from any and all public, private or corporate parties to manage and operate (in a similar or new capacity) the Bloedel Conservatory. The process still enables the Park Board and City to choose a useage for the Conservatory that is other than our beautiful floral oasis. The Conservatory will remain open while they consider all Expressions of Interests.

Friends of the Bloedel submitted our Expression of Interest in partnership with the VanDusen Botanical Garden Association. This is now being considered along with 3 other proposals from private companies. A report about the EOI's will be made at the Services and Budget Committee on the evening of Tuesday, July 20th at the Park Board office Boardroom at 6:30pm (2099 Beach Avenue). This committee will then vote and make their recommendation to the full Park Board.
